Zusammenfassung
Laparoskopische Operationen über nur einen Trokar (Single-port-Technik) verfolgen wie NOTES „natural orifice transluminal endoscopic surgery“ das Ziel, das Zugangstrauma durch weitere Minimierung der Hautinzisionen zu verringern. Zur Durchführung sind spezielle Trokare und Instrumente notwendig, die in dieser Arbeit in ihrer Anwendung und Funktion dargestellt werden. Das Indikationsspektrum entspricht dem der „konventionellen“ laparoskopischen Chirurgie. Die bisherigen Publikationen zeigen, dass Operationen in Single-port-Technik sicher und effizient durchführbar sind, wobei ein höherer operativer Schwierigkeitsgrad und höhere Kosten berücksichtigt werden müssen. Für den Nachweis signifikanter Vorteile fehlen bisher randomisierte Studien.
Abstract
Laparoscopic operations using only one trocar (single-port technique) have the aim to further minimize the trauma of access incisions similar to NOTES. To carry this out special trocars and instruments are needed which are presented in this article with respect to application and function. The range of indications corresponds to the conventional laparoscopic surgery. Recent publications have shown that operations using a single-port technique are safe and efficient. Greater technical difficulties and higher costs must be considered. For the identification of significant advantages, randomized studies are still lacking.
